Default A6 compressor

I have a 1969 427 with the original A6 A/C compressor. It finally blew a seal and I hade it replaced with an aftermarket compressor. I am still using r12 in the system. I have the original A6 compressor. My question is should I have the original one rebuilt and reinstall or buy a new A6. . I would like to keep the car original. Any suggestions ?

I'd suggest that you just rebuild the original unit (if it is not damaged internally). You know that it was working properly; you can't be sure of that anymore with a "new" one...

Is the broken one your original? If it's original and you are leaning toward having the car judged, you should consider having the original rebuilt.
